(1) An application to the Appellate Authority under sub-section (2) of section 107 of the Act shall be made
in FORM GST APL-03, electronically.

(2) A hard copy of the application in FORM GST APL-03 shall be submitted in triplicate to the Appellate
Authority and shall be accompanied by a certified copy of the decision or orderappealed against along
with the supporting documents within seven days of filing the application under sub-rule (1) and an
appeal number shall be generated by the Appellate Authority or an officer authorised by him in this
behalf.
